In gambling and decision-making contexts, bracketing effects play a critical role in shaping how individuals approach stake selection, influencing both risk perception and behavioral outcomes. Bracketing refers to the cognitive strategy where people group or separate decisions in ways that affect their willingness to assume risk. In stake selection, this means that a player may treat a series of bets as a single, aggregated decision or as separate, independent choices, with the framing affecting their perceived risk and potential reward. Understanding the bracketing effect allows for deeper insights into why players often deviate from purely rational models and how their betting patterns can be predicted or guided in both casual and professional gambling environments.
When players adopt a broad bracketing approach, they consider multiple stakes collectively. For example, a gambler placing ten individual bets of $10 each may mentally aggregate these as one $100 commitment. This broad perspective can lead to more conservative decision-making because the total potential loss becomes more salient, encouraging players to minimize overall risk. Broad bracketing encourages a form of risk averaging, where the player is more sensitive to the cumulative effect of losses rather than isolated outcomes. It promotes strategic thinking that balances potential gains with total exposure, making it less likely for a player to make impulsive, high-risk bets that might seem tolerable when considered individually.
Conversely, narrow bracketing occurs when a player treats each stake independently, evaluating the risk and reward of each decision in isolation. In this scenario, the emotional and cognitive weight of potential losses is reduced, since the focus is on a single, immediate outcome rather than the aggregated risk. Narrow bracketing often leads to higher risk-taking behavior because the potential downside of one bet feels manageable, even if the cumulative risk across multiple bets is substantial. Players may feel more confident in experimenting with larger or more uncertain stakes when each decision is mentally separated from the others. This framing can create a sense of immediate excitement and engagement, driving impulsive betting behavior that would be mitigated under broad bracketing.
Research on bracketing effects demonstrates that players’ risk preferences are highly sensitive to context. When stakes are bracketed broadly, individuals often display loss aversion, emphasizing the avoidance of overall negative outcomes. The fear of a cumulative loss can override the appeal of potential gains, leading to more cautious behavior and systematic stake management. On the other hand, narrow bracketing can exaggerate the allure of small, frequent wins, promoting a gambler’s optimism and willingness to accept risks that seem isolated and non-threatening. This divergence in behavior underscores the importance of framing in stake selection, as the same objective probabilities and payouts can be perceived differently depending on whether bets are considered individually or collectively.
Another important factor is the interplay between cognitive load and bracketing. Broad bracketing requires the player to maintain an awareness of cumulative risk, which involves tracking multiple outcomes and integrating them into a single mental representation. This cognitive effort can moderate impulsivity and encourage more disciplined betting patterns. Narrow bracketing, by simplifying the decision to a single event, reduces mental load, potentially increasing emotional reactivity and the influence of short-term impulses. The balance between cognitive demand and emotional reward is therefore central to how bracketing effects manifest in stake selection. Players who are highly focused and reflective may naturally adopt broad bracketing strategies, whereas those seeking immediate excitement may gravitate toward narrow bracketing, highlighting the personal and situational variability in gambling behavior.
The design of gambling interfaces and environments can also shape bracketing effects. Platforms that display cumulative statistics, account balances, or aggregated bet histories can encourage broad bracketing by making the total stakes more salient. Conversely, interfaces emphasizing individual rounds, quick spins, or isolated outcomes may promote narrow bracketing, heightening the perception of each bet as a standalone decision. Understanding these design influences allows operators to guide player behavior subtly, aligning risk-taking tendencies with desired engagement patterns or responsible gaming practices. For instance, showing players the potential cumulative loss of multiple bets upfront can nudge them toward more cautious stake selection, reinforcing broad bracketing principles.
Bracketing effects also intersect with emotional responses to wins and losses. Under narrow bracketing, a single win can be disproportionately rewarding, increasing confidence and encouraging subsequent riskier bets. The emotional high is experienced independently of prior losses, which may remain psychologically segregated due to the isolated framing. Broad bracketing, in contrast, blends emotional reactions across multiple bets, tempering the highs and lows by embedding individual outcomes within a larger context. This can foster a more stable emotional response, reducing extreme swings in behavior and promoting sustained engagement without escalating risk exposure.
Training and education in risk management often exploit bracketing insights. Players who are taught to aggregate decisions mentally are more likely to implement self-imposed limits and maintain disciplined bankroll management. Recognizing the cognitive distortions introduced by narrow bracketing helps individuals understand why they may chase losses or overestimate their control in sequential betting scenarios. By consciously adopting a broad bracketing mindset, players can achieve a better alignment between subjective perceptions and objective probabilities, improving decision quality and fostering long-term satisfaction with their gaming experience.
